Demon Slayer season 3 episode 9 recap & review: Mist Hashira Muichiro Tokito

In Demon Slayer season 3 episode 9, Tokito takes on Gyokko as he tries to finish the job and the Upper-Rank demon.

Recap

Tokito faces off against Gyokko, who still can’t overcome his need to be recognized as an artisan or help the fact that he’s a massive nuisance. Muichiro doesn’t play into any of his ploys and doesn’t get swayed. In fact, it is he who delivers Gyokko several humiliating remarks.

When the demon slayer calls his vases asymmetrical and a piece of crap, Gyokko can’t hold it any longer and launches his Blood Demon Art. However, Muichiro makes quick work of it and expels all his opponent’s attacks. He later takes on Gyokko and his moves with ease, defeating the slayer with an impressive set of moves.

After insulting Gyokko and his creations, Tokito takes on his enraged set of moves, guarding against the demon with unnaturally focused energy. Finally, Tokito manages to kill others and perish Gyokko’s body, before succumbing to his wounds and injuries and beginning to foam from his mouth.

Before finishing him off, Tokito remembers how after his brother’s death, Lady Amane helped with his rescue and recovery, before Tokito forgot about the event and started training like an animal. In the present day, the battle between Tanjiro’s faction and Hantengu takes a worse shape.

The new, combined form of the demon leaves no space for Tanjiro to wriggle out of, bombarding him with the attacking wooden dragons, which manage to give his foot a nasty cut, burst his eardrums, and make him dread the battle.

When all hope seems lost, and the wooden dragons have almost crushed Tanjiro, Nezuko, and Genya, it’s the Love Hashira Kanroji who comes to the rescue.

Review

  • Mitsuri’s entry is both reassuring and awe-inspiring, as her attacks manage not just to push back Hantengu but prevent him from dealing more critical damage to Tanjiro and company.
  • Demon Slayer season 3 episode 9 is best when it’s focused on Muichiro, who himself is preternaturally focused while taking on the vase demon.
  • Unlike other demons, Gyokko’s backstory isn’t revealed and he dies before the soppy routine of coming to terms with their humanity is run.
